![]() The direct join link is intended to deal with situations in which a speaker finds out that they cannot join an event when their assigned session is about to start. This feature also allows event hosts to help speakers bypass issues they may experience while joining an event. Note: The 1-week timeframe is based on the event start time, as it’s specifically 168 hours beforehand. The direct join link is intended to provide a significant amount of lead time for hosts and speakers to rehearse ahead of an event. Hosts can create direct join links for speakers one week before an event starts. The direct join link allows speakers to quickly join a session on the Zoom desktop client, even when they are not signed in, with any credentials. ![]() Zoom Events hosts can create a direct join link for speakers.
